摘要
采用极化扭转式卡氏天线、四喇叭馈源和波导混合环式和差网络实现了8 mm波快速扫描单脉冲天线。给出了天线各部分的设计、公差分析和仿真。由于设计时进行了详细的公差分析,样机几乎未经任何调试,便全面满足设计要求,主要指标与仿真结果非常吻合,表明给出的设计方法和公差分析对工程设计有较强的指导意义。
A fast scanning mm- wave monopulse antenna was realized by using Cassegrain antenna with twist - reflector, four horn feed and wavegnide hybrid - ring sum and difference network. Design, error analysis and simulation of the antenna are presented. Because of analyzing the errors detailedly, the experimental results of prototype without nearly any adjusting agree with design value well. It vrefies that the methods of design and error analyzing are available for engineering application.
